+/// Creates external API functions for an array UDF. Specifically, creates
+///
+/// 1. Single `ScalarUDF` instance
+///
+/// Creates a singleton `ScalarUDF` of the `$UDF` function named `$GNAME` and a
+/// function named `$NAME` which returns that function named $NAME.
+///
+/// This is used to ensure creating the list of `ScalarUDF` only happens once.
+///
+/// # 2. `expr_fn` style function
+///
+/// These are functions that create an `Expr` that invokes the UDF, used
+/// primarily to programmatically create expressions.
+///
+/// For example:
+/// ```text
+/// pub fn array_to_string(delimiter: Expr) -> Expr {
+/// ...
+/// }
+/// ```
+/// # Arguments
+/// * `UDF`: name of the [`ScalarUDFImpl`]
+/// * `EXPR_FN`: name of the expr_fn function to be created
+/// * `arg`: 0 or more named arguments for the function
+/// * `DOC`: documentation string for the function
+/// * `SCALAR_UDF_FUNC`: name of the function to create (just) the `ScalarUDF`
+/// * `GNAME`: name for the single static instance of the `ScalarUDF`
+///
+/// [`ScalarUDFImpl`]: datafusion_expr::ScalarUDFImpl
+macro_rules! make_udf_function {
+    ($UDF:ty, $EXPR_FN:ident, $($arg:ident)*, $DOC:expr , 
$SCALAR_UDF_FN:ident) => {
+        paste::paste! {
+            // "fluent expr_fn" style function
+            #[doc = $DOC]
+            pub fn $EXPR_FN($($arg: Expr),*) -> Expr {
+                Expr::ScalarFunction(ScalarFunction::new_udf(
+                    $SCALAR_UDF_FN(),
+                    vec![$($arg),*],
+                ))
+            }
+
+            /// Singleton instance of [`$UDF`], ensures the UDF is only 
created once
+            /// named STATIC_$(UDF). For example `STATIC_ArrayToString`
+            #[allow(non_upper_case_globals)]
+            static [< STATIC_ $UDF >]: 
std::sync::OnceLock<std::sync::Arc<datafusion_expr::ScalarUDF>> =
+                std::sync::OnceLock::new();
+
+            /// ScalarFunction that returns a [`ScalarUDF`] for [`$UDF`]
+            ///
+            /// [`ScalarUDF`]: datafusion_expr::ScalarUDF
+            pub fn $SCALAR_UDF_FN() -> 
std::sync::Arc<datafusion_expr::ScalarUDF> {
+                [< STATIC_ $UDF >]
+                    .get_or_init(|| {
+                        
std::sync::Arc::new(datafusion_expr::ScalarUDF::new_from_impl(
+                            <$UDF>::new(),
+                        ))
+                    })
+                    .clone()
+            }
+        }
+    };
+}

+//! [`ScalarUDFImpl`] definitions for array functions.
+
+use arrow::datatypes::DataType;
+use datafusion_common::{plan_err, DataFusionError};
+use datafusion_expr::expr::ScalarFunction;
+use datafusion_expr::Expr;
+use datafusion_expr::{ColumnarValue, ScalarUDFImpl, Signature, Volatility};
+use std::any::Any;
+
+// Create static instances of ScalarUDFs for each function
+make_udf_function!(ArrayToString,
+    array_to_string,
+    array delimiter, // arg name
+    "converts each element to its text representation.", // doc
+    array_to_string_udf // internal function name
+);
+
+#[derive(Debug)]
+pub(super) struct ArrayToString {
+    signature: Signature,
+    aliases: Vec<String>,
+}
+
+impl ArrayToString {
+    pub fn new() -> Self {
+        Self {
+            signature: Signature::variadic_any(Volatility::Immutable),
+            aliases: vec![
+                String::from("array_to_string"),
+                String::from("list_to_string"),
+                String::from("array_join"),
+                String::from("list_join"),
+            ],
+        }
+    }
+}
+
+impl ScalarUDFImpl for ArrayToString {
+    fn as_any(&self) -> &dyn Any {
+        self
+    }
+    fn name(&self) -> &str {
+        "array_to_string"
+    }
+
+    fn signature(&self) -> &Signature {
+        &self.signature
+    }
+
+    fn return_type(&self, arg_types: &[DataType]) -> 
datafusion_common::Result<DataType> {
+        use DataType::*;
+        Ok(match arg_types[0] {
+            List(_) | LargeList(_) | FixedSizeList(_, _) => Utf8,
+            _ => {
+                return plan_err!("The array_to_string function can only accept 
List/LargeList/FixedSizeList.");
+            }
+        })
+    }
+
+    fn invoke(&self, args: &[ColumnarValue]) -> 
datafusion_common::Result<ColumnarValue> {
+        let args = ColumnarValue::values_to_arrays(args)?;
+        crate::kernels::array_to_string(&args).map(ColumnarValue::Array)
+    }
+
+    fn aliases(&self) -> &[String] {
+        &self.aliases
+    }
+}
